A bull's eye is the center point of an archery target or shooting range that is marked with concentric circles. The term bull's eye is also used figuratively to describe a specific goal or objective that is being aimed for. In both cases, hitting the bull's eye is considered a great achievement. Archers and shooters train for years to perfect their aim and accuracy to hit the bull's eye. The term bull's eye can also be used in a broader sense to describe any precise or perfect hit, such as hitting a target in a specific location or achieving a specific goal.
